Counselling Connect

Organization Type: Community-based Organization

Priority Population(s) Served:

  • 2SLGBTQIA+
  • ACB
  • Indigenous Peoples
  • LGBTQ+
  • People of colour
  • People who use drugs
  • Newcomers
  • Youth

City/Town: Ottawa

Health Region: Ottawa

HIV Specific: No

Substance Use Care: Yes

General Contact:

Website: https://www.counsellingconnect.org/

Mental Health Services Available: Individual Counselling, Family Counselling, Substance Use Counselling, Support Groups

Additional Services Offered:

Eligibility Requirements: Live in Ottawa and surrounding area. Must be a member of the community for programs for specific populations: African, Caribbean, and Black Counselling program, Indigenous Counselling program, 2SLGBTQIA+ Counselling program, Newcomers - Immigrants and Refugees Counselling. Free.

How to make a referral? Individuals can self-refer and book sessions online through the website.

Languages Varies by program: English, French, Spanish, Arabic, Creole, Farsi, Mandarin (not available currently but check back)

Language interpretation services available? No

Virtual services? Yes

Length of services 1-3 free sessions

Wait times No waitlist
